General Motors has just unveiled two products, Sail hatchback and MPV, brought in from the joint venture partner SAIC’s portfolio. These vehicles will be launched in the market this year. General Motors is not letting out more details on the same and answers are not being taken up, though it is expected to be taken up some time.
Powering this new hatchback will be the 1.2-litre petrol engine that does duty in the Beat petrol with the possibility of a Multijet diesel finding its way into the engine bay later on. The Sail will be launched here during the second half of next year.
CHEVY SAIL
- Sail has been reworked in Banglore over the last one and half year to meet the requirements in India.
- Car has leather interiors , CD player with AUX
- Sail will have 1.2-litre petrol and 1.3-litre diesel engine.
- Chevy might have to borrow diesel for this hatch.
- The Sail is a decently successful model in the global market.
- GM may also bring the sedan Sail and possibly replace the Aveo in the coming months.
CHEVY SAIC CN 100
- Every manufacture believes that MPV or MUV market is growing and deserves attention.
- Yesterday we saw Nissan Evalia, Hyundai Hexa Space and now this Chevy SAIC.
- SAIC is being developed considering India and other emerging markets.
- Toyota Innova will certainly have lot of competition soon.
